Electric scooters allowed on campus, not allowed inside campus buildings

Author: NDWorks

Mc 11

As we prepare for the beginning of a new academic year, please be aware of updates to our electric scooter policy.  

For the safety of those coming and going across campus, e-scooters are no longer allowed in hallways, stairwells or common areas of any University building.

Scooters may be stored inside residence hall rooms or private offices. When not in these locations, scooters must be parked at bike racks or other outside areas to allow safe and easy access to all buildings, including residence halls.

Scooters must be registered with the Notre Dame Police Department. Registration is free and can be accessed online or by visiting Hammes Mowbray Hall. All scooter operators must also agree and adhere to responsible use and safety guidelines.
